SFC и DISM: Проверка и Восстановление системных файлов в Windows

Поэтому, если в результате тех или иных действий ваша система отказывается грузиться, и вы подозреваете (а то и твердо уверены), что дело в подмене важного системного файла порченным экземпляром, вы можете выполнить проверку целостности системных файлов, используя WinRE (Windows Recovery Enviroment), прямо на «упавшей» системе.

Восстановление среды Windows Recovery Environment (WinRE) в Windows 10

Среда восстановления Windows Recovery Environment (WinRE) представляет собой минимальную ОС на базе среды предварительной установки Windows Preinstallation Environment (WinPE), в которую включен ряд инструментов для восстановления, сброса и диагностики ОС Windows. В том случае, если основная ОС по какой-то причине перестает загружаться, компьютер пытается запустить среду восстановления WinRE, которая в автоматическом (или ручном режиме) может помочь исправить возникшие проблемы.

В некоторых случаях компьютер не может загрузиться в среде Windows Recovery Environment из-за различных проблем. В этой статье мы рассмотрим основные способы восстановления среды WinRE на примере Windows 10 (для Windows 7 и Windows 8.1 процедура аналогична).

Восстановление среды Windows Recovery Environment (WinRE) в Windows 10

Причины, по которым среда WinRE перестает грузится или работает некорректно, в общем случае могут быть разными:

  • Среда WinRE отключена на уровне настроек Windows.
  • В хранилище конфигурации загрузки (BCD) отсутствуют записи для загрузки в режиме восстановления
  • Файл с образом среды отсутствует или перемещен
  • Отсутствует или содержит некорректные данные файл конфигурации WinRE —

Запуск утилиты из среды восстановления Windows 7

1. Вставьте установочный диск Windows 7 в DVD-привод, и загрузитесь с DVD. Дождитесь появления этого окна: Выставьте раскладку клавиатуры «США» и нажмите «Далее».

2. В следующем окне щелкните «Восстановление системы».

3. Теперь выберите в списке тот экземпляр Windows 7, который поврежден, и нажмите «Далее». У меня он один.

4. Запустите командную строку

Чтобы проверить и восстановить один конкретный файл, напечатайте [code]sfc /scanfile=X:\windows\ /offbootdir=X:\ /offwindir=X:\windows[/code]

Замените X: на букву раздела, где находится ваша система.

Чтобы проверить полностью все файлы операционной системы, выполните команду [code]sfc /scannow /offbootdir=X:\ /offwindir=X:\windows[/code]

Вас не обманывают, проверка действительно может занять некоторое время, в моем случае она продолжалась порядка 7 минут. По её завершении утилита выведет путь к журналу своей работы, и расскажет, что она делала с системными файлами.

Поделиться этой статьёй:

Вы здесь: Главная страница » Windows » Windows 7 » Проверка системных файлов Windows 7 из среды восстановления WinRE

Публикации по теме

  • Как избавиться от лишней перезагрузки при двойной загрузке Windows 8.1 и Windows 7
  • Как задать разные иконки для открытой и закрытой папки Проводника
  • Как добавить в Компьютер в Windows 7 папки как в Windows 8
  • Как переместить библиотеки под компьютер в Windows 7 в области переходов Проводника
  • Что делать, если возникла ошибка 0x0000005 и не работают программы в Windows 7 после обновления KB2859537
  • Самый быстрый способ починить кэш иконок в Windows 8, Windows 7 и Windows Vista
  • Как добавить пункт «Закрепить в меню Пуск» в контекстное меню папки
  • Управление папками с фоновыми рисунками рабочего стола
  • Эффективный поиск из меню «Пуск», не печатая много букв
  • Как переименовать сразу несколько файлов в Проводнике Windows
  • Ad-hoc подключение (компьютер-компьютер) в Windows 7 Starter
  • Ключи командной строки утилиты
  • Устраняем ошибку CDBOOT: Cannot boot from CD – Code: 5
  • Медицинская карта батареи ноутбука средствами Windows 7
Читайте также:  Лучшие виртуальные машины: Hyper-V, VirtualBox, VMware

Проверка и Восстановление системных файлов через CMD

Средство проверки системных файлов сканирует ваш компьютер на предмет любого повреждения или изменений в системных файлах, которые в противном случае могли бы помешать нормальной работе вашего ПК. Инструменты заменяет файл правильной версией, чтобы обеспечить бесперебойную работу. С помощью командной строки можно попытаться сканировать и восстановить системные файлы поздних операционных систем, как Windows 10/8/7 /Vista. Разберем две команды sfc /scannow и DISM с помощью CMD.

Проверка и Восстановление системных файлов через CMD

1. Использование инструмента System File Checker (SFC)

Запустите командную строку (CMD) от имени администратора. Нажмите «поиск» и напишите просто «cmd» или «командная строка», далее по ней правой кнопкой мыши и запуск от имени админа.

Проверка и Восстановление системных файлов через CMD

Задайте команду sfc /scannow и дождитесь окончания процесса.

Примечание: После сканирования вашей системы будет выдан один из трех результатов:

Проверка и Восстановление системных файлов через CMD
  • Ошибок системных файлов не будет.
  • Будут ошибки системных файлов и Windows восстановит их автоматически.
  • Windows обнаружила ошибки, но не может восстановить некоторые из них.

Если у вас показывает вариант 3, что ошибка обнаружена и система не может восстановить, то загрузитесь в безопасном режиме и проделайте заново процедуру. Советую отключить шифрование EFS и Bitlocker, если на момент проверки они имеются. Ничего не получилось? Двигаемся ниже.

Проверка и Восстановление системных файлов через CMD

2. Использование инструмента Deployment Image and Service Management  (DISM)

Если вышеуказанное не работает в безопасном режиме, есть один последний способ проверить повреждение в системных файлах и исправить их. Используем инструмент Deployment Image and Service Management (DISM). Команда работает с системами Windows 8/8.1/10. Откройте обратно командную строку от имени администратора и используйте следующую команду:

Проверка и Восстановление системных файлов через CMD
  • DISM /ONLINE /CLEANUP-IMAGE /RESTOREHEALTH

Процесс может занять длительное время с зависанием процентной шкалы. Закончив работу, перезагрузите компьютер и запустите обратно sfc /scannow, чтобы убедиться, что ошибок нет или ошибка пропала.

Проверка и Восстановление системных файлов через CMD

Среда восстановления Windows — запуск WinRE из работающей системы

Сначала рассмотрим запуск среды восстановления Windows 10 из работающей операционной системы.

Среда восстановления Windows — запуск WinRE из работающей системы

1 способ:

  1. Войдите в меню «Пуск», запустите приложение «Параметры».
  2. Нажмите на «Обновление и безопасность».
  3. Откройте раздел «Восстановление», в опции «Особые варианты загрузки» нажмите на кнопку «Перезагрузить сейчас».
Среда восстановления Windows — запуск WinRE из работающей системы

2 способ:

Среда восстановления Windows — запуск WinRE из работающей системы

3 способ:

  1. Запустите командную строку.
  2. В окне интерпретатора командной строки введите команду, а затем нажмите на «Enter»:
Среда восстановления Windows — запуск WinRE из работающей системы

shutdown /r /o /t 0 После выполнения перезагрузки, последуют следующие действия:

  1. После выполнения перезагрузки компьютера, откроется окно «Выбор действия». Нажмите на кнопку «Поиск и устранение неисправностей».
  2. В окне «Диагностика» нажмите на «Дополнительные параметры».
  3. В окне «Дополнительные параметры» отображены основные компоненты среды восстановления Windows RE:
Среда восстановления Windows — запуск WinRE из работающей системы
  • Восстановление системы — восстановление Windows при помощи точек восстановления.
  • Удалить обновления — удаление установленных обновлений и исправлений системы из Windows.
  • Восстановление образа системы — восстановление Windows с помощью заранее созданного образа системы.
  • Восстановление при загрузке — восстановление загрузчика Windows.
  • Командная строка — запуск командной строки для решения проблем и устранения неполадок.
  • Параметры встроенного ПО UEFI — доступ к параметрам BIOS UEFI.
Читайте также:  Как установить WSL 2 подсистему Windows для Linux 2 в Windows 10

Восстановление Windows в предыдущем рабочем состоянии будет возможным при наличие ранее созданных точек восстановления системы или резервного образа системы. Параметры встроенного ПО UEFI отображаются на современных компьютерах с UEFI, на ПК со старым BIOS этого параметра не будет.

Среда восстановления Windows — запуск WinRE из работающей системы

Нажмите на ссылку «Просмотреть другие параметры восстановления» для доступа к другим инструментам:

Среда восстановления Windows — запуск WinRE из работающей системы
  • «Параметры загрузки» — настройка параметров загрузки Windows.

Среда восстановления Windows — запуск WinRE из работающей системы

Выберите подходящий параметр для выполнения необходимых действий.

Среда восстановления Windows — запуск WinRE из работающей системы

Возможности

Как и в Windows Vista, среда восстановления в Windows 7 предоставляет вам следующие возможности:

  • Восстановление запуска в автоматическом режиме исправляет проблемы, препятствующие загрузке Windows 7. Это средство можно использовать, если загрузочные файлы повреждены или затерты загрузчиком другой операционной системы.
  • Восстановление системы позволяет вернуться к точке, созданной до возникновения проблемы. Иногда это средство также позволяет восстановить запуск системы. Безусловно, должна быть включена защита системы, иначе точек восстановления не будет.
  • Восстановление образа системы представляет собой мастер, который проведет вас через шаги восстановления системы из образа, заранее созданного средствами архивации Windows.
  • Диагностика памяти Windows проверяет оперативную память на ошибки. Как правило, видимым проявлением ошибок в оперативной памяти является синий экран (BSOD). При появлении синего экрана проверку памяти можно использовать в качестве первого диагностического средства.
  • Командная строка позволяет выполнять широкий диапазон действий от операций с файлами до запуска редактора реестра, что также можно использовать для восстановления нормальной работы системы.

Video: Восстановление Windows 10

Обязательно нужно указать язык, на котором вводится пароль вашей учетной записи, иначе вы не сможете на следующем шаге ввести его. Для доступа к командной строке требуется учетная запись администратора. Что делать, если вы потеряли пароль админа смотреть в этой статье.

Теперь нам предлагается выполнить вход в систему. Выбираете вашу учетную запись и вводите пароль от нее.

Если вы все сделали правильно, то откроется окно «Параметры восстановления системы», ради которого все и затевалось.

Восстановление или Сброс системы

Если после указанного выше у вас не пропали проблемы с системой, можете попробовать применить более радикальные действия. Запустив инструмент Восстановление системы вы восстановите файлы операционной системы до более раннего состояния и это может устранить ошибки и сбои в работе системы если она не была повреждена ещё раньше.

Перейти к просмотруПерейти к просмотру

Восстановление или Сброс системы

Не стоит также забывать о сбросе системы или её переустановке. В Windows 10, 8.1, and 8 можно запустить операцию Сброс системы («Reset this PC») для сброса настроек в начальное состояние.

Читайте также:  установка rdp windows server 2016 без домена

Осуществляя сброс системы будьте внимательны, так как есть два варианта сброса:

  • – без удаления файлов – без потери фотографий, музыки, видео и других личных файлов;
  • – с удалением всех данных – возврат в исходное состояние.

В случае выбора второго варианта восстановить ваши данные стандартными средствами Windows уже не представляется возможным. И если данная функция была выбрана случайно, то без сторонних программ для восстановления файлов вам никак не обойтись.

Команды, которые мы рассмотрели в статье, также имеют и другие функции. Например, команда SFC может проверить только один из файлов Windows на повреждение и восстановить его. С помощью команды DISM можно произвести проверку системы на повреждения, но не восстанавливать её.

Восстановление или Сброс системы

Команды SFC и DISM – это очень удобные функции, которые Microsoft разработал для того, чтобы позаботится о своей операционной системе. И это очень хорошо, что такие команды есть, часто они помогают спасти операционную систему, а вместе с ней и большие объёмы важных файлов.

Способ – Использование диска восстановления

Если Windows 10 не загружается, вы можете попробовать произвести реанимацию системы с помощью диска восстановления, который позволит вам получить доступ к дополнительным параметрам запуска.

После загрузки с USB-диска восстановления перейдите в раздел «Диагностика -> Дополнительные параметры».

Здесь вы можете использовать несколько вариантов реанимации компьютера:

Способ – Использование диска восстановления
  1. Восстановление Windows с помощью точки восстановления. Это вариант мы уже рассматривали выше. Смысл его тот же, только запуск производится другим путем.
  2. Восстановление образа системы. Этот метод известен еще с Windows 7. Если вы ранее создали образ системы в Windows, то можно легко его восстановить через диск восстановления.
  3. С помощью следующего пункта вы можете попробовать автоматически исправить ошибки при загрузке.
  4. Для более продвинутых пользователей есть возможность запустить командную строку для восстановления системы или других целей.
  5. Ну и последний вариант – это возвращение Windows к предыдущей сборке.

Также следует отметить, что если при создании диска восстановления системы вы произвели запись системных файлов на диск, то у вас будет возможность переустановить Windows с этого диска. Но если вы покупали компьютер с предустановленной Window 8 (8.1) со скрытым разделом восстановления, то будет восстановлена версия системы, которая изначально поставлялась с компьютером.

Общие сведения о среде восстановления

Во время установки Windows 7 на жестком диске автоматически создается служебный раздел, содержащий среду восстановления Windows RE (Recovery Environment).

Используя служебный раздел Windows RE, вы можете:

  • загрузиться в среду восстановления с жесткого диска
  • создать компакт-диск, содержащий среду восстановления

Это позволит вам вернуть систему к жизни даже в том случае, если она не загружается. При этом не требуется установочный диск операционной системы, как это было в случае с Windows Vista

Это очень важное усовершенствование Windows 7, которое должно особенно порадовать владельцев предустановленных систем, не имеющих установочного диска. Если раньше ОЕМ производители реализовывали собственные решения по восстановлению, то теперь они могут просто добавлять собственный пользовательский интерфейс к процедуре восстановления образов из Windows RE.